Type
ORACLE
Validation date
2024-09-18 10:47: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(36 B)

{
  "uco": {
    "eur": 0.01105,
    "usd": 0.0123
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

00012B60E3C3B6A298FED86103800B73FF9E97F6592A349577D4C4DA1154F8574976

Previous signature

6D970AA6E26B8417F9089A6052D17E7CD8603002A3D0EFDF686A5C4ABFFE7AE77E803532E3D4AD4F313091BCE7786117E7DC727454AA9F16D000496EC527590A

Origin signature

304402202433E16FF5C584FD656CE28F3BDB68F46B1D4BB04B7B9389D889C719644837430220013D3FAD8306FBC9AD4B0BF3BDC504AA75DE8945DBD47D3B157561FC6B0E6D18

Proof of work

010104641D2D652B2A36CDE32EABB7AC1D6F0351A1CFAE45BA1483ADAD99B166DB289E9E408C13C28D10F62F068EE552C651FAA5A2BD6417D68EAFC8C269FBD2FBE9E3

Proof of integrity

00DBC876B8228B6FF44E80BB6723705667A5F3423C5B3E6D194ABC56F11728C29C

Coordinator signature

0663FB2CD1CAF31607E8D64F8FA95F609E636A1A586F3386EAADCB5A90F5C4FFEAAF4E0BCC1654EE655951B6C70C56C96B7B79FB36A09D1AD515E05AA158CE03

Validator #1 public key

00016A24FA6FC34A345FB22A7E90CB6BC583AEA140B679549F745FB51D59A93F7868

Validator #1 signature

39B16C1B48D67D6F90B6303D92DED4ACA16DF5C7CFD86F39A97592E8C94C899CD8914FD1B1212C007C0859A1356DC7781EB870F1CAADDEDD6AFECF6797304A00

Validator #2 public key

00010F74B5FEB03F130C26B66BB24AA5066168510220DC9D6C2590294863AC9C8DEE

Validator #2 signature

6CBCBEEA67D53166C884289306E0698C57F68F7BCA524B239E5178B47DFAE97492DF07AAE6A4D3BD096A3171BCF361F5D7EB2F28FCA43AB1BBE33237DFDB0509